First: Carbohydrates!
Should carbohydrates be avoided in your diet. There are a number of high-protein diets on the market that does promote a diet rich in protein and low in carbohydrates. These types of diets can produce major weight loss very quickly, but the results rarely last for long, and as soon as you begin normal meals again, the weight creeps back on, sometimes more than before!
Second: Genetics I was born with it!
To a certain extent, genetics does play a part in your body’s metabolism, but this doesn’t mean you are doomed in losing weight; it just makes it more difficult. The factor in determining your weight loss lies in the calorie content of the food you eat and how much exercise you get each day. Genetics plays a role in deciding how many calories you will burn. A slow metabolic rate will burn calories slower; however, a fast rate burns calories much quicker. There are ways to get around this Genetics thing, and you can do it, just don’t give up.
Third: Fat should be avoided!
Some believe that cutting down on all fat is necessary while you are trying to lose weight. However, the key factor in fat control is cutting down on the bad one’s like saturated and trans fat and increase your intake of the better fats such as polyunsaturated and Omega-3. fish, avocados and olive oil are a great source for good fats.
Fourth: Skipping Meals!
Skipping meals will make it more difficult to lose weight. Regular meals are necessary to keep your metabolism working correctly and when you skip meals, you have a tendency to gorge yourself when the opportunity presents itself. You need to train your mind to think healthy, this means more foods like vegetables, salads, nuts and fruits!
